I've been using Movie Studio for some time now and never had a problem like this. Because Windows 7 was being phased out, I decided to get a new Laptop (Lenovo ThinkPad P52S Windows 10 Pro with 32GB memory and 1TB HDD). Movie Studio 16 worked under Windows 7, but when I downloaded the Movie 16 build 142 (twice now) and install on the Windows 10 computer. All I can do is activate it (enter my SN and email) and then it just hangs with the Movie Studio 16 Flash screen. Progress seems to stop about 1/3 way on the progress bar. Task Manager shows 0% activity for Movie Studio. After about 15-20, I just kill the process. This isn't normal. See screenshot below:

There are no other programs running. I have restarted and uninstall and reinstall a couple of times. Is there a fix for this? Is there a work around? Any one able to run Movie Studio 16 under Windows 10 Pro?

Thank you for your response. However, the program still won't load. I'm now stuck on "initializing external monitoring". I have tried different things - 1) Run as Administrator, 2) add /NODEXGROVEL, 3) Run under various compatibility mode Win7/Win8/No Compatibility, and 4) checked/unchecked Windows Presentation foundation Font Cache. I have reboot the machine each time between testing each scenario otherwise Movie Studio will not start. So right now, I have /NODEXGROVEL and this gets me farther, but I'm still unable to launch Movie Studio. Below is a summary:

Ok, first the GOOD NEWS. Movie Studio Launched!!! So Thank you for your help.

FYI, this is what I did:

1) I went to #18 and reset to default and checked the box as instructed. This didn't help.

2) I then went to step#8. I removed all external hardware - all HDD, two monitors, etc. The System launched! But I really want my external monitors to work.

3) I first plugged back my external HDDs. System Launched! Good.

4) I plugged in Monitor #1, System Launched! Good.

5) I plugged in Monitor #2, System Lauched! Good. This is too good to be true.

6) Then for the heck of it, I deleted out the /NODXGROVEL switch and the program launched!!

I'm guessing that I initially got in after Step #2 because the system then "register" something internally after completing it launch and therefore allow me to get in with all my external devices, but because I couldn't get in to complete the "final step" because of "interference by other hardware device". This is like a chicken and egg issue. I could be wrong, but that's what I think at least for now. The system is now as if it was a new install - no switches or compatibility settings.
